Brian Lampton
Profile
Brian Lampton is an American politician currently serving as a member of the Ohio House of Representatives. He represents the 70th district, having previously served the 73rd district before redistricting. Lampton first won his seat in the 2020 general election, defeating Democratic challenger Kim McCarthy with 57.5% of the vote. He succeeded Republican incumbent Rick Perales, who was term-limited after completing his fourth term in office.
